THQ Ceases Japanese Publishing February 29th

The troubled publisher of games like Saints Row: The Third, UFC Undisputed 3, and SpongeBob SquarePants: Operation Krabby Patty will be closing its Japanese publishing division at the end of this month. This confirms rumors previously reported by Kotaku Australia.

With CEOs taking paycuts and rumors of the publisher completely folding up after releasing its planned 2013 slate of games, it's no surprise that international offices are feeling the pinch as well.

Caught in the crossfire? Valhalla Studios, a development house started by Tomonobu Itagaki and others of Team Ninja heritage who are currently developing Devil's Third for THQ. We'll update with more once information comes to light.
